Open Access in MSCA o open access to PUBLICATIONS Ömandatory under H2020 o open access to RESEARCH DATA Ö on a voluntary basis under H2020 • Should Open Science be further embedded in MSCA?  If Yes, to which extent and how? ¾ MSCA Advisory Group ¾ Stakeholders with expertise in Open Science ¾ Members States Open Science in MSCA: what future?
